Chemical Property Profile of Hydrazinecarboxamide, N-(4-bromophenyl)-2-((1-methyl-1H-pyrrol-2-yl)methylene)-
Property Insights of Hydrazinecarboxamide, N-(4-bromophenyl)-2-((1-methyl-1H-pyrrol-2-yl)methylene)-
The XLogP value of 2.9432 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Hydrazinecarboxamide, N-(4-bromophenyl)-2-((1-methyl-1H-pyrrol-2-yl)methylene)-. With a topological polar surface area (TPSA) of 58.42 Ų, Hydrazinecarboxamide, N-(4-bromophenyl)-2-((1-methyl-1H-pyrrol-2-yl)methylene)- ex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Hydrazinecarboxamide, N-(4-bromophenyl)-2-((1-methyl-1H-pyrrol-2-yl)methylene)- has 2 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
